Coral is a Clan Chymist converted from the Wyld Runner box set. At the time, no Clan Chymist model was commercially available. I do not regret building her, however, because I an not a fan of the mechanics of the Shivver, and the Chymist and Shivver come together. She’ll hopefully never see combat but technically you need a miniature for her or else she automatically leaves the gang if you suffer a raid on your gang’s base.
The paint for these is a simple Contrast blend over Wraithbone with a few extra details like metal. I made the weapons pink and the boots black for gang colors, but everything else is a 90’s style neon frenzy.
